The bottling and marketing of purified water began in the early eighties - I was sure it was going to follow the same path as the rubix cube, and be just another 80s fad that would slowly fade away....Not so! During the 1996 Clean Up Australia Day water bottles were amongst the ten most common garbage items to be collected.

Through workshops held as part of Brisbane's Too High Young Women and the Arts Festival, Reservoir Grrrls from looked at how water is packaged and marketed and at the reasons we buy bottled water, specially since the basic chemical composition in most brands of bottled water is much the same as tap water.

Reservoir Grrls put together a series of stickers that you can stick on yr water bottle when you reuse it, featuring spoof brands like the mouthwatering 'Brisbane River', the beat stomping 'Pulse' and for sporty types, 'Tap'. The stickers also have information about the pollution that water bottles create, how to find out more about your water supply as well as some handy hints on how to purify your own water.
